Like many NBA stars, Charles Barkley surrounded himself with a supportive family to help him during strenuous points in his career. NBA fans popularly nick named Barkley as ‘the Round Mound of Rebound’. Many fans consider ‘Sir Charles’ as an NBA legend. Barkley recently talked about his father’s demise.

Former NBA star Charles Barkley revealed details about his relationship with his father. Barkley spoke about his father while speaking on his podcast, ‘The Steam Room’ with co-host Ernie Johnson. He described the gradual improvement of his relationship with his father before his unfortunate demise.

Barkley said, “And last and definitely not least, my dad passed away Christmas week. And me and my dad have had a complicated relationship. I want to make it perfectly clear, for the last long years of our life, we have had a great relationship. We had a rocky relationship the first probably 20, 30 years of my life.”

Charles Barkley and his childhood career and familial ties

Born in 1968, Charles Barkley was raised in Leeds, Alabama. Barkley had a rough childhood with his father Frank Barkley abandoning his family after divorcing Barkley’s mother, Charcey Glenn. His mother however moved on and remarried. Barkley’s stepfather passed away in an accident when the former was just 11 years old.

Studying at Leeds High School, Barkley failed to secure a spot on the varsity’s roster partially because of his short stature. As a senior on the team, he averaged 19.1 points and 17.9 rebounds per game. In the state high school semi finals, Barkley scored 26 points paving a way to a successful college career and an NBA career.
